Today the children worked with the early simple machines sets.
One group built a merry-go-round and another group built a crane car.

After group one completed their merry-go-round they decided to build a car.
This was a great idea since group two had built a crane was working on a gas station.
The crane pulled the car to the gas station for some servicing.

We also built a bumper for our car so that we could get it to the gas station without using our hands.
In the end, both groups counted how many pieces it took to build their projects.
Some projects took only 16 pieces while others took 24.
